What is the tidal volume of an average 70kg adult?

Tidal volume is the volume of gas inhaled or exhaled during a normal breath. The tidal volume of an average adult is approximately 500 to 600 mL.

What are the complications of tidal volume?

Complications of tidal volume include barotrauma (lung damage from high pressures), volutrauma (lung damage from excessive stretch), and ventilator-associated lung injury. Inadequate tidal volume can lead to hypoventilation and hypercapnia, while excessive tidal volume can cause ventilator-induced lung injury. Close monitoring and adjustment of tidal volume is important to avoid these complications.


What is relation between tidal volume minute volume and breath rate?

Minute volume is calculated by multiplying tidal volume by breath rate. Tidal volume is the amount of air inhaled or exhaled in one breath, while breath rate is the number of breaths taken per minute. By multiplying tidal volume and breath rate, you can determine the amount of air exchanged in one minute.
